{"id":"https://openalex.org/W2973530015","doi":"https://doi.org/10.1145/3356317.3356325","title":"What is the adoption level of automated support for testing in open-source ecosystems?","display_name":"What is the adoption level of automated support for testing in open-source ecosystems?","publication_year":2019,"publication_date":"2019-09-16","ids":{"openalex":"https://openalex.org/W2973530015","doi":"https://doi.org/10.1145/3356317.3356325","mag":"2973530015"},"language":"en","primary_location":{"id":"doi:10.1145/3356317.3356325","is_oa":false,"landing_page_url":"https://doi.org/10.1145/3356317.3356325","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the IV Brazilian Symposium on Systematic and Automated Software Testing","raw_type":"proceedings-article"},"type":"article","indexed_in":["crossref"],"open_access":{"is_oa":false,"oa_status":"closed","oa_url":null,"any_repository_has_fulltext":false},"authorships":[{"author_position":"first","author":{"id":"https://openalex.org/A5060635839","display_name":"R\u00f4mulo Martins da Silva","orcid":"https://orcid.org/0009-0003-3765-4526"},"institutions":[{"id":"https://openalex.org/I161127581","display_name":"Universidade Federal Fluminense","ror":"https://ror.org/02rjhbb08","country_code":"BR","type":"education","lineage":["https://openalex.org/I161127581"]}],"countries":["BR"],"is_corresponding":true,"raw_author_name":"R\u00f4mulo Martins da Silva","raw_affiliation_strings":["Universidade Federal Fluminense, Niter\u00f3i, Rio de Janeiro, Brazil"],"affiliations":[{"raw_affiliation_string":"Universidade Federal Fluminense, Niter\u00f3i, Rio de Janeiro, Brazil","institution_ids":["https://openalex.org/I161127581"]}]},{"author_position":"middle","author":{"id":"https://openalex.org/A5042740440","display_name":"Cafer Cruz","orcid":null},"institutions":[{"id":"https://openalex.org/I161127581","display_name":"Universidade Federal Fluminense","ror":"https://ror.org/02rjhbb08","country_code":"BR","type":"education","lineage":["https://openalex.org/I161127581"]}],"countries":["BR"],"is_corresponding":false,"raw_author_name":"Cafer Cruz","raw_affiliation_strings":["Universidade Federal Fluminense, Niter\u00f3i, Rio de Janeiro, Brazil"],"affiliations":[{"raw_affiliation_string":"Universidade Federal Fluminense, Niter\u00f3i, Rio de Janeiro, Brazil","institution_ids":["https://openalex.org/I161127581"]}]},{"author_position":"middle","author":{"id":"https://openalex.org/A5021761918","display_name":"Heleno de S. Campos","orcid":"https://orcid.org/0000-0001-5541-0021"},"institutions":[{"id":"https://openalex.org/I161127581","display_name":"Universidade Federal Fluminense","ror":"https://ror.org/02rjhbb08","country_code":"BR","type":"education","lineage":["https://openalex.org/I161127581"]}],"countries":["BR"],"is_corresponding":false,"raw_author_name":"Heleno de S. Campos","raw_affiliation_strings":["Universidade Federal Fluminense, Niter\u00f3i, Rio de Janeiro, Brazil"],"affiliations":[{"raw_affiliation_string":"Universidade Federal Fluminense, Niter\u00f3i, Rio de Janeiro, Brazil","institution_ids":["https://openalex.org/I161127581"]}]},{"author_position":"middle","author":{"id":"https://openalex.org/A5102931782","display_name":"Leonardo Murta","orcid":"https://orcid.org/0000-0002-5173-1247"},"institutions":[{"id":"https://openalex.org/I161127581","display_name":"Universidade Federal Fluminense","ror":"https://ror.org/02rjhbb08","country_code":"BR","type":"education","lineage":["https://openalex.org/I161127581"]}],"countries":["BR"],"is_corresponding":false,"raw_author_name":"Leonardo G. P. Murta","raw_affiliation_strings":["Universidade Federal Fluminense, Niter\u00f3i, Rio de Janeiro, Brazil"],"affiliations":[{"raw_affiliation_string":"Universidade Federal Fluminense, Niter\u00f3i, Rio de Janeiro, Brazil","institution_ids":["https://openalex.org/I161127581"]}]},{"author_position":"last","author":{"id":"https://openalex.org/A5006573368","display_name":"V\u00e2nia de Oliveira Neves","orcid":"https://orcid.org/0000-0003-4648-2263"},"institutions":[{"id":"https://openalex.org/I161127581","display_name":"Universidade Federal Fluminense","ror":"https://ror.org/02rjhbb08","country_code":"BR","type":"education","lineage":["https://openalex.org/I161127581"]}],"countries":["BR"],"is_corresponding":false,"raw_author_name":"V\u00e2nia de Oliveira Neves","raw_affiliation_strings":["Universidade Federal Fluminense, Niter\u00f3i, Rio de Janeiro, Brazil"],"affiliations":[{"raw_affiliation_string":"Universidade Federal Fluminense, Niter\u00f3i, Rio de Janeiro, Brazil","institution_ids":["https://openalex.org/I161127581"]}]}],"institutions":[],"countries_distinct_count":1,"institutions_distinct_count":5,"corresponding_author_ids":["https://openalex.org/A5060635839"],"corresponding_institution_ids":["https://openalex.org/I161127581"],"apc_list":null,"apc_paid":null,"fwci":0.0,"has_fulltext":false,"cited_by_count":2,"citation_normalized_percentile":{"value":0.15414102,"is_in_top_1_percent":false,"is_in_top_10_percent":false},"cited_by_percentile_year":{"min":89,"max":94},"biblio":{"volume":null,"issue":null,"first_page":"80","last_page":"89"},"is_retracted":false,"is_paratext":false,"is_xpac":false,"primary_topic":{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":0.9998999834060669,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},"topics":[{"id":"https://openalex.org/T10260","display_name":"Software Engineering Research","score":0.9998999834060669,"subfield":{"id":"https://openalex.org/subfields/1710","display_name":"Information Systems"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T10743","display_name":"Software Testing and Debugging Techniques","score":0.9991999864578247,"subfield":{"id":"https://openalex.org/subfields/1712","display_name":"Software"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}},{"id":"https://openalex.org/T11675","display_name":"Open Source Software Innovations","score":0.9905999898910522,"subfield":{"id":"https://openalex.org/subfields/1706","display_name":"Computer Science Applications"},"field":{"id":"https://openalex.org/fields/17","display_name":"Computer Science"},"domain":{"id":"https://openalex.org/domains/3","display_name":"Physical Sciences"}}],"keywords":[{"id":"https://openalex.org/keywords/open-source","display_name":"Open source","score":0.7708848714828491},{"id":"https://openalex.org/keywords/javascript","display_name":"JavaScript","score":0.7581285238265991},{"id":"https://openalex.org/keywords/computer-science","display_name":"Computer science","score":0.7540864944458008},{"id":"https://openalex.org/keywords/python","display_name":"Python (programming language)","score":0.580804169178009},{"id":"https://openalex.org/keywords/software-engineering","display_name":"Software engineering","score":0.565159261226654},{"id":"https://openalex.org/keywords/source-code","display_name":"Source code","score":0.522095799446106},{"id":"https://openalex.org/keywords/test","display_name":"Test (biology)","score":0.5211910605430603},{"id":"https://openalex.org/keywords/world-wide-web","display_name":"World Wide Web","score":0.4886341691017151},{"id":"https://openalex.org/keywords/public-domain-software","display_name":"Public domain software","score":0.47828444838523865},{"id":"https://openalex.org/keywords/open-source-software","display_name":"Open source software","score":0.4238147735595703},{"id":"https://openalex.org/keywords/test-case","display_name":"Test case","score":0.4121493101119995},{"id":"https://openalex.org/keywords/data-science","display_name":"Data science","score":0.355247437953949},{"id":"https://openalex.org/keywords/software","display_name":"Software","score":0.30214834213256836},{"id":"https://openalex.org/keywords/programming-language","display_name":"Programming language","score":0.2448137402534485},{"id":"https://openalex.org/keywords/machine-learning","display_name":"Machine learning","score":0.14438700675964355}],"concepts":[{"id":"https://openalex.org/C3018397939","wikidata":"https://www.wikidata.org/wiki/Q3644502","display_name":"Open source","level":3,"score":0.7708848714828491},{"id":"https://openalex.org/C544833334","wikidata":"https://www.wikidata.org/wiki/Q2005","display_name":"JavaScript","level":2,"score":0.7581285238265991},{"id":"https://openalex.org/C41008148","wikidata":"https://www.wikidata.org/wiki/Q21198","display_name":"Computer science","level":0,"score":0.7540864944458008},{"id":"https://openalex.org/C519991488","wikidata":"https://www.wikidata.org/wiki/Q28865","display_name":"Python (programming language)","level":2,"score":0.580804169178009},{"id":"https://openalex.org/C115903868","wikidata":"https://www.wikidata.org/wiki/Q80993","display_name":"Software engineering","level":1,"score":0.565159261226654},{"id":"https://openalex.org/C43126263","wikidata":"https://www.wikidata.org/wiki/Q128751","display_name":"Source code","level":2,"score":0.522095799446106},{"id":"https://openalex.org/C2777267654","wikidata":"https://www.wikidata.org/wiki/Q3519023","display_name":"Test (biology)","level":2,"score":0.5211910605430603},{"id":"https://openalex.org/C136764020","wikidata":"https://www.wikidata.org/wiki/Q466","display_name":"World Wide Web","level":1,"score":0.4886341691017151},{"id":"https://openalex.org/C172092558","wikidata":"https://www.wikidata.org/wiki/Q1037852","display_name":"Public domain software","level":4,"score":0.47828444838523865},{"id":"https://openalex.org/C2988343187","wikidata":"https://www.wikidata.org/wiki/Q1130645","display_name":"Open source software","level":3,"score":0.4238147735595703},{"id":"https://openalex.org/C128942645","wikidata":"https://www.wikidata.org/wiki/Q1568346","display_name":"Test case","level":3,"score":0.4121493101119995},{"id":"https://openalex.org/C2522767166","wikidata":"https://www.wikidata.org/wiki/Q2374463","display_name":"Data science","level":1,"score":0.355247437953949},{"id":"https://openalex.org/C2777904410","wikidata":"https://www.wikidata.org/wiki/Q7397","display_name":"Software","level":2,"score":0.30214834213256836},{"id":"https://openalex.org/C199360897","wikidata":"https://www.wikidata.org/wiki/Q9143","display_name":"Programming language","level":1,"score":0.2448137402534485},{"id":"https://openalex.org/C119857082","wikidata":"https://www.wikidata.org/wiki/Q2539","display_name":"Machine learning","level":1,"score":0.14438700675964355},{"id":"https://openalex.org/C86803240","wikidata":"https://www.wikidata.org/wiki/Q420","display_name":"Biology","level":0,"score":0.0},{"id":"https://openalex.org/C151730666","wikidata":"https://www.wikidata.org/wiki/Q7205","display_name":"Paleontology","level":1,"score":0.0},{"id":"https://openalex.org/C152877465","wikidata":"https://www.wikidata.org/wiki/Q208042","display_name":"Regression analysis","level":2,"score":0.0}],"mesh":[],"locations_count":1,"locations":[{"id":"doi:10.1145/3356317.3356325","is_oa":false,"landing_page_url":"https://doi.org/10.1145/3356317.3356325","pdf_url":null,"source":null,"license":null,"license_id":null,"version":"publishedVersion","is_accepted":true,"is_published":true,"raw_source_name":"Proceedings of the IV Brazilian Symposium on Systematic and Automated Software Testing","raw_type":"proceedings-article"}],"best_oa_location":null,"sustainable_development_goals":[],"awards":[],"funders":[],"has_content":{"grobid_xml":false,"pdf":false},"content_urls":null,"referenced_works_count":14,"referenced_works":["https://openalex.org/W1524053243","https://openalex.org/W1527355805","https://openalex.org/W2030653458","https://openalex.org/W2036514392","https://openalex.org/W2078483536","https://openalex.org/W2106072155","https://openalex.org/W2106191864","https://openalex.org/W2115919801","https://openalex.org/W2140952846","https://openalex.org/W2141852905","https://openalex.org/W2146511370","https://openalex.org/W2151099659","https://openalex.org/W2804669502","https://openalex.org/W4213279169"],"related_works":["https://openalex.org/W4319870556","https://openalex.org/W2108777707","https://openalex.org/W4286377578","https://openalex.org/W2056828497","https://openalex.org/W2902006350","https://openalex.org/W2171191843","https://openalex.org/W2066276518","https://openalex.org/W4283764951","https://openalex.org/W1988957473","https://openalex.org/W1983748582"],"abstract_inverted_index":{"In":[0,38],"the":[1,14,24,43,81,95,149],"last":[2],"decades,":[3],"different":[4,34],"kinds":[5],"of":[6,27,45,116,122],"automated":[7,29,46,86,171],"support":[8,30,47,87],"for":[9,48,159],"testing":[10,49,150],"have":[11,20,94],"emerged":[12],"in":[13,31,75,140,168],"open-source":[15,53,66,129],"community.":[16],"However,":[17],"we":[18,41,56,70,107,146,174],"still":[19],"limited":[21],"evidence":[22],"about":[23],"adoption":[25,44],"level":[26],"such":[28],"practice,":[32],"considering":[33],"programming":[35,161],"language":[36,162],"ecosystems.":[37],"this":[39,142,180],"paper,":[40],"investigate":[42,58],"among":[50],"184":[51],"popular":[52],"projects.":[54,67],"Besides,":[55],"also":[57,108,147],"test":[59,97,134],"coverage":[60,135],"and":[61,78,88,91,103,119,124],"metrics":[62],"correlations":[63,112],"on":[64,100,179],"571":[65],"As":[68],"results,":[69],"found":[71,109],"that":[72,83,89,127,155,182],"projects":[73,93],"written":[74],"Go,":[76],"PHP,":[77],"JavaScript":[79,90],"are":[80,156],"ones":[82],"most":[84,157],"adopt":[85],"Python":[92],"largest":[96],"coverage,":[98],"with,":[99],"average,":[101],"84%":[102],"81%,":[104],"respectively.":[105],"Moreover,":[106],"overall":[110],"negligible":[111],"between":[113],"projects'":[114],"amount":[115],"stars,":[117],"commits":[118],"source":[120],"lines":[121],"code":[123],"coverage.":[125],"Knowing":[126],"an":[128],"project":[130],"has":[131],"a":[132,176],"high":[133],"may":[136,165],"enhance":[137],"users'":[138],"confidence":[139],"using":[141],"project.":[143],"Besides":[144],"that,":[145],"listed":[148],"tools,":[151],"libraries":[152],"or":[153],"frameworks":[154],"adopted":[158],"each":[160],"ecosystem.":[163],"It":[164],"help":[166],"developers":[167],"choosing":[169],"appropriate":[170],"support.":[172],"Finally,":[173],"established":[175],"research":[177],"agenda":[178],"topic":[181],"motivates":[183],"deeper":[184],"studies":[185],"as":[186],"future":[187],"work.":[188]},"counts_by_year":[{"year":2024,"cited_by_count":1},{"year":2023,"cited_by_count":1}],"updated_date":"2025-11-06T03:46:38.306776","created_date":"2025-10-10T00:00:00"}
